Located on Meard Street in the city's West End, the Grade II-listed residence was built in 1732 by John Meard and was most ...
Behind its Georgian façade lies nearly 300 years of layered London history, beginning with its builder, John Meard, a carpenter who helped restore St Paul’s Cathedral after the Great Fire of London.
